The rubber replica holster weighs 1.84 lbs or 692 grams. I've owned a real Nemrod holster and I dont remember it being as heavy as the rubber replica. I never took the time to weigh it though.

Before I got the FP replica I made one out of For Sale signs. I used pictures of the real one to approximate the size and shape. I used an MLC sidearm at the time so I made sure it fit that. I layered fiberglass/ resin around it for stability and then painted it up. Cost about $15 bucks in material.
